Design Notes
We use promoter activated by cueO first. But after discuss with NJAU, we found that cueO promoter is not very specific on copper ion. So we change to use copA promoter. Which is more specific. Source
using part: CopA (promoter)
B0030 (RBS)
E1010 (RFP)
B0015 (Terminator)
